Celebrating 61 years, the Ak-Sar-Ben Rodeo has had a long-standing tradition for being the largest indoor rodeo in Nebraska. Tracing its roots back to 1947, the rodeo has attracted many of the worldÃs best rodeo cowboys and entertainers. The impressive list includes such legends as Roy Rogers, the Judds, Gene Autry, Brooks & Dunn, Reba McEntire and many more.
In 2003 the Ak-Sar-Ben Rodeo became host to the ProRodeo Summer Finale which as brought national exposure to both the rodeo and Ak-Sar-Ben's River City Roundup through national print publications and national television broadcasts.
Six years later Ak-Sar-Ben's River City Roundup still plays host to a major Playoff event as the host to the Wrangler ProRodeo Tour - Omaha Round of the Ariat Playoffs.
The Ak-Sar-Ben Rodeo Committee is a group of volunteers who coordinate the production of the Omaha Round of the Ariat Playoffs. This group sets up the arena, handles the rodeo production each night and promotes the event throughout the community.
